WebBuild a small teepee of sticks around a fire starter like paper or cardboard and light it like you would a campfire. Add charcoal, coal, or wood to your fire as it gets hotter and larger. Turn on your bellows when you have a decent heat started and get to work on your projects! Step 10: Final Notes Obviously this is just a template.

Blacksmithing for beginners. Blacksmithing basics. Make your own blacksmith tongs... growfin fish feedAlways wear safety equipment when working with and around the forge. At a minimum, you should wear safety glasses and natural fiber clothing, like a long sleeve cotton canvas work shirt and pants, to protect your skin. Set up your forge in an outdoor space.
